1. Introduction to Epichlorohydrin
Epichlorohydrin is an organic compound primarily used in various industrial applications. It has a reactive epoxy group and a chlorine atom, making it versatile in chemical processes. The primary use of epichlorohydrin is in the production of epoxy resins, which are used in coatings, adhesives, and plastics.
2. Epoxy Resin Production
The most significant use of epichlorohydrin is in the creation of epoxy resins. These resins are valued for their strong adhesive properties and chemical resistance. Industries use epoxy resins in everything from electrical insulation to marine coatings. The widespread demand for durable and chemical-resistant materials drives the increasing need for epichlorohydrin.
Application | Industry | Key Benefit |
---|---|---|
Adhesives | Construction | Strong bonding |
Coatings | Marine, Automotive | Chemical and water resistance |
Insulation | Electronics | Electrical resistance |
3. Water Treatment Applications
Another important use of epichlorohydrin is in water treatment chemicals. It is a key component in the production of polyamines and polyquaternary compounds, which are used to purify water. These compounds help remove contaminants and ensure clean, safe water.
4. Rubber and Plastic Manufacturing
Epichlorohydrin is also used to manufacture synthetic rubbers and plastics. The resulting materials have superior resistance to oils, chemicals, and heat. This makes them suitable for automotive seals, hoses, and other demanding environments where durability is essential.
